The place of La Catalina is inside the municipality of San Miguel Tlacamama (in the State of Oaxaca). There are 48 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#6 of the ranking. La Catalina is at 240 meters of altitude.

Data: In La Catalina, 100% of the inhabitants are catholic and 70% of the dwellings are equipped with a washing machine. At the bottom of this page you will find more information.

You can find it at 4.9 kilometers, in direction Southwest, from the town of San Miguel Tlacamama, which has the largest population within the municipality.
